Astronaut Colonel William Pogue wore a yellow-dial Seiko ref. 6139 on his Skylab 4 mission in 1973, making it the first automatic chronograph to travel to space. Because of this, it's become one of the most collectible vintage Seikos and also something enthusiasts are always demanding a link reissue link of. The defining features of the "Pogue" are link the red-blue bezel and vibrant yellow dial (for real nerds, Colonel Pogue wore a 6139-005 "Resist" model).
